Clearheaded and Giddy

Clearheaded

Clearheaded adjective - Having full use of one's mind and control over one's actions.

Giddy is an antonym for clearheaded.

Giddy

Giddy adjective - Having a feeling of being whirled about and in danger of falling down.
Usage example: I love the giddy feeling you get riding roller coasters

Clearheaded is an antonym for giddy.
